After a pandemic-induced delay, the long-awaited and highly anticipated luxury hotel at the Palace of Versailles is now open — just in time for Americans to travel to a newly reopened France. The Airelles Château de Versailles, Le Grand Contrôle became the seventh property for the high-end chain and one of the most desirable hotels on …